Summa Health is seeking an enthusiastic, board certified/board eligible physician for an excellent employed Occupational Medicine position. This is a position with significant growth opportunities, in a very supportive, collegial workplace. The successful candidate will practice at one of our busiest Corporate Health Centers in Cuyahoga Falls, OH. Candidates with the following specialties will be considered if they have training and/or experience in Occupational Medicine ER, UC, Ortho, Trauma, Physiatrist, and Primary Care.

There are 6 Summa Corporate Health Centers within the Summa Health System. Summa Corporate Health Centers are linked to a network of free-standing and hospital based emergency departments whose emergency medicine physicians are equipped to provide the right treatment. All of our Summa Corporate Health locations offer access to physical therapy, occupational therapy and rehabilitation services.

Summa Health headquartered in Akron, Ohio is one of the largest integrated Healthcare Delivery Systems in the state. With 5 hospitals and 20 health centers, Summa Health provides access to care throughout the Northeast Ohio region.

Candidate Requirements

  • Board Certification/Board Eligibility - Occupational Medicine, Internal Medicine, Family Medicine, Urgent Care, Emergency Medicine
  • Medical Review Officer (MRO) certification needed but can be obtained after physician is hired
  • Treat/evaluate work related injuries; provide direct patient care to patients and employees including physicals
  • Flexible schedules will be considered: 3 or 4 day work week
  • Unrestricted Ohio licensure
  • The successful candidate will have the following skills: suturing, reading x-rays, familiarity with foreign body removal
  • Oversight of Nurse Practitioners is required
  • FMCSA examiner certification needed, but can be obtained after physician is hired
